An insurance SEO specialist, not a generalist
Insurance is a "Your Money, Your Life" category. Insurance content faces heightened scrutiny on experience, expertise, authoritativeness and trust. Insurance keywords are dominated by price comparison sites and household-name insurers. Insurance marketing is governed by FCA rules that limit what brands can say and how.
